What is the average salary in Champlin, MN?

The average salary in Champlin, MN is $52,382 per year.

Champlin, MN offers a diverse job market with competitive salaries. The average yearly salary in Champlin is $52,382. This figure reflects the variety of job opportunities available across different sectors. Workers in Champlin can find jobs that match a range of skills and experience levels.


Salaries in Champlin vary by industry. Some of the highest-paying job categories include finance, healthcare, and technology. For instance, those in the finance sector often earn between $63,614 and $72,705 per year. Similarly, healthcare professionals can expect salaries ranging from $54,523 to $99,977 annually. Technology jobs also offer attractive pay, with salaries starting around $45,432 and going up to $127,250. How does the cost of living in Champlin, MN compare to the national average?

Champlin, MN, boasts a cost of living index that closely mirrors the nationwide average, making it a favorable location for job seekers. While the housing costs are slightly lower at 95, transportation expenses are also a bit less at 90. Groceries and healthcare costs are only marginally different, sitting at 98 and 96, respectively, while utilities and miscellaneous expenses are on par with the national average. This balance makes Champlin an attractive option for those looking to manage living expenses effectively.
Cost of living comparison graph for Champlin, MN vs. Nationwide: housing 5% lower, groceries 2% lower, utilities 0% lower, transportation 10% lower, healthcare 4% lower, miscellaneous 3% lower.

Champlin, MN, offers a cost of living that provides potential residents with a balanced financial landscape compared to the nationwide average. The housing index is at 95, which is 5% below the national average. This makes housing in Champlin more affordable for those considering a move. Similarly, groceries cost slightly less than the average, at 98. This indicates that food expenses remain quite competitive.


Transportation costs in Champlin are at 90, which means they are 10% less than the national average. This can be a significant saving for residents who depend on personal vehicles. Healthcare costs are slightly lower at 96, which is a 4% reduction compared to the nationwide average. Miscellaneous expenses also stand at 97, showing a minor reduction from the average.
